Inleiding tot PostgreSQL-gegevenstypen

De database van elk systeem is beschouwd als de basis voor elk detail van het systeem. Alle toepassingen die met de gegevens werken, moeten een database hebben waarin alle toepassingsgerelateerde gegevens zijn opgeslagen. Omdat we weten dat de gegevens als een zeer cruciaal onderdeel van elk systeem worden beschouwd, moet er een platform zijn dat kan helpen bij het verwerken en beheren van de gegevens. Hier in dit artikel gaan we meer te weten over de gegevenstypen van het databasebeheersysteem PostgreSQL. Omdat de database zich zorgen maakt over de gegevens, kunnen er verschillende soorten gegevens in de database worden opgeslagen. Hier zullen we de soorten gegevens zien die kunnen worden opgeslagen of waarmee kan worden gewerkt, met behulp van PostgreSQL.

PostgreSQL-gegevenstypen

Het gegevenstype kan worden gedefinieerd als een soort gegevens. In eenvoudige bewoordingen kan de variabele die is toegewezen aan een van de gegevenstypen alleen de waarde van dat gegevenstype opslaan. Als bijvoorbeeld een variabele de integerwaarden alleen zou moeten opslaan, slaat deze in alle gevallen alleen de integerwaarde op. Als de gebruiker de waarde van verschillende gegevenstypen in die variabele probeert in te voeren, leidt dit tot de fout.

Hieronder staan ​​enkele van de gegevenstypen in PostgreSQL: -

  • Boolean - Boolean is een van de gegevenstypen die door PostgreSQL worden ondersteund. Dit gegevenstype kan slechts twee waarden opslaan die "True" en "False" zijn. In normale gevallen worden de Booleaanse waarden gebruikt om te controleren of de instructie correct is. Als de instructie correct is, wordt de echte waarde geretourneerd, anders is de waarde false. Dit gegevenstype wordt ook gebruikt bij de besluitvorming en op basis van een van de twee waarden moet de beslissing door het programma worden genomen. Voorbeeld - "True", "False"
  • Char Data Type - Het char data type wordt gebruikt om een ​​enkele karakterwaarde op te slaan. Het heeft meestal de voorkeur om te worden gebruikt op de plaats waar het slechts een enkel karakter moet opslaan. Als de gebruiker hier meer dan één teken in probeert te plaatsen, leidt dit tot een fout. De variabele met de char-waarden neemt zeer weinig ruimte in beslag. Voorbeeld - 'A', 'a', 'm' enz
  • Tekstgegevenstype - de variabele met het gegevenstype omdat de tekst de lange tekenreekswaarden kan opslaan. In alle gevallen waarin de lengte van de tekst die moet worden opgeslagen onbekend is, kan het gegevenstype tekst worden gebruikt. In andere programmeertalen is er het gegevenstype string dat de set tekens kan bevatten. Op dezelfde manier is de tekst hier aanwezig om de tekenreeks of tekenset op te slaan. Voorbeeld - "Hallo", "Gefeliciteerd" enz
  • Varchar (n) Gegevenstype - Het Varchar-gegevenstype met een nummer erbij geschreven geeft aan dat het in staat is om alleen het aantal tekens op te slaan of te houden dat ernaast staat. Als we bijvoorbeeld varchar (9) schrijven, betekent dit dat de variabele alleen het maximum aan leuke tekens kan bevatten. Voorbeeld - "ABCDEFGHI", "Hallo Hey"
  • Geheel gegevenstype - De variabele die is gedefinieerd met het gegevenstype geheel getal kan alleen de waarde van het gehele getal opslaan. De waarde moet de gehele waarde zijn, anders zal de fout worden gegenereerd. Als bijvoorbeeld een variabele met de naam i de integerwaarde moet opslaan, bevat deze alleen de integerwaarde. Voorbeeld - 1.200.459.354 enz
  • Tijdgegevenstype - Het tijdgegevenstype wordt toegewezen aan de variabele die alleen de tijdwaarde zou moeten opslaan. Er moet een bepaald tijdformaat zijn dat moet worden opgeslagen in de variabele voor het gegevenstype tijd. Het is een van de belangrijkste gegevenstypen in PostgreSQL omdat het wordt gebruikt om de transacties bij te houden. Voorbeeld - 12:00:36, 01:06:56
  • Interval Data Type - De variabele die is toegewezen aan het interval datatype kan een bepaald tijdsinterval opslaan. Het maakt zich zorgen over de tijd en kan in verschillende gevallen worden gebruikt om de tijd te schatten. In de database wordt oprecht opgemerkt dat welke transactie met welk interval heeft plaatsgevonden en dit gegevenstype ons helpt om de intervallen te beheren. Voorbeeld - '7 maanden geleden', '2 jaar 5 uur 40 minuten'
  • Array - De array wordt gebruikt om de reeks tekenreeksen of een reeks waarden op te slaan, maar de enige beperking is dat alle waarden in de array van hetzelfde gegevenstype moeten zijn. Het gebruik van de array maakt het programma ruim handig om te worden begrepen door iedereen die niet het onderdeel was terwijl de code werd ontwikkeld. Voorbeeld - ARRAY (408) -589-5846 ′, '(408) -589-5555 ′)
  • UUID-gegevenstype - Het UUID-gegevenstype wordt gebruikt om de Universally Unique Identifiers op te slaan. Dit zijn eigenlijk de waarden die in het hele programma worden gebruikt om iets uniek te identificeren. Het is een speciaal soort gegevenstype dat niet kan worden gevonden in programmeertalen op hoog niveau. Voorbeeld - 0e37df36-f698-11e6-8dd4 - cb9ced3df976, a81bc81b-dead-4e5d-abff-90865d1e13b1
  • JSON Data Type - De variabele waarvan wordt verondersteld dat deze de JSON-waarden opslaat, wordt toegewezen aan het JSON-gegevenstype. Het is een van de belangrijkste gegevenstypen die in PostgreSQL worden gebruikt en die de complexe JSON-gegevens kan bevatten. Voorbeeld - ("client": "Doe", "items": ("product": "Application", "qty": 7))

Conclusie

Het PostgreSQL-databasebeheer kan als zeer nuttig worden beschouwd wanneer het wordt gebruikt voor elke toepassing die met de gegevens moet werken. Het is ontworpen om te werken met verschillende soorten gegevenstypen waarbij alle gegevenstypen hun eigen belang hebben. Ook zijn er gegevenstypen zoals tijd, datum, interval, etc. aanwezig om de tijd bij te houden terwijl de transacties worden uitgevoerd. In sommige besturingssystemen zoals Kali Linux is PostgreSQL ingebouwd beschikbaar. Het maakt het zeer gemakkelijk voor de ontwikkelaars om hun applicatie te integreren met de database en ze kunnen ook de verschillende soorten gegevenstypen gebruiken die beschikbaar zijn gesteld in PostgreSQL.

Aanbevolen artikelen

Dit is een handleiding voor PostgreSQL-gegevenstypen. Hier hebben we een inleiding besproken met verschillende gegevenstypen van PostgreSQL. U kunt ook onze andere voorgestelde artikelen doornemen voor meer informatie -

  1. Wat is PostgreSQL?
  2. Hoe PostgreSQL installeren?
  3. PostgreSQL-stringfuncties
  4. Vragen tijdens solliciteren bij PostgreSQL
  5. Python-gegevenstypen
  6. Verschillende soorten SQL-gegevens met voorbeelden